Bakery Manager: Store Simulator is a casual simulation game where you manage a bakery on one of the hottest strips in town. You get to serve customers, scan items, handle cash, and manage stock to keep the line moving and shoppers smiling. As your bakery gains popularity, you can unlock new bakery goods, upgrade the store, and expand the business into the town’s go-to destination for sweet treats and more.

How to Play Bakery Manager: Store Simulator

You’re the newest baker in the town of Doughville, and your goal is to become a bakery icon in Bakery Store Manager: Store Simulator, where you get to turn a shop with empty shelves into a bustling morning hot stop.

Your first step is to pick up the package waiting outside the bakery, then stack your shelves with donuts. Once your shelves are at least partly full, you can open your shop by flipping the “Closed” sign outside. Hungry guests will begin to arrive, so be ready to serve them.

Stock Your Shelves

Keep your shelves stocked to keep customers happy, and don’t let them wait too long before checking out and buying their pastries. When you need more inventory, head to your computer to place an order for waffles, strawberry pastries, donuts, and white bread. Be careful not to order more than you can store. If you overstock, you’ll have to invest in more shelving or refrigerators.

Every item ordered has its place. For example, pastries and donuts belong in the refrigerator, while cereals and bread go on the shelves. It’s essential to order the right products for the amount of space you have.

As you level up, you’ll unlock licenses that allow you to sell more than just donuts. Follow the objectives to earn bonus XP and level up faster. Soon, your bakery can expand to include sodas, everyday groceries, canned goods, extra cereals, and much more. Each license unlocks at the level that matches its number, so License 2 becomes available when you reach Level 2. The levels continue with greater upgrades, taking your bakery from start-up to dessert empire. Keep baking, purchasing, and checking out customers, and you will be on your way to bakery icon!

Tip

When you place your first order, you’ll be able to set your prices. Choose wisely to make a profit without scaring off customers.

help Frequently Asked Questions

How do I serve customers in Bakery Manager: Store Simulator? expand_more
Click on the customer to see their order, then click on the items they want to serve them.
How can I upgrade my bakery in the game? expand_more
Earn coins by serving customers efficiently and use them to purchase upgrades for your bakery.
What happens if I run out of stock in Bakery Manager: Store Simulator? expand_more
Make sure to keep an eye on your stock levels and restock items before they run out to keep customers happy.
Are there different levels of difficulty in the game? expand_more
The game starts off easy and gradually increases in difficulty as you progress, challenging you to manage more customers and stock.
Do you have any tips for managing the bakery efficiently? expand_more
Try to prioritize serving customers quickly, restocking items regularly, and investing in upgrades to make your bakery more efficient.
